数据库 · 19 10 月, 2024

Oracle 11g 五大獨特特能的描述

Oracle 11g 五大獨特特能的描述

Oracle 11g 是 Oracle 公司推出的一款關鍵數據庫管理系統,廣泛應用於企業級應用中。它不僅提供了強大的數據處理能力,還具備多項獨特的功能,能夠滿足不同業務需求。本文將深入探討 Oracle 11g 的五大獨特特能。

1. 自動化管理功能

Oracle 11g 引入了自動化管理功能,這使得數據庫的管理變得更加簡單和高效。透過自動化的監控和調整,數據庫能夠自動識別性能瓶頸並進行優化。這一功能不僅減少了人工干預的需求,還能夠提高系統的穩定性和可靠性。

示例:

-- 自動化性能調整示例
EXEC DBMS_AUTO_SQLTUNE.EXECUTE_TUNING_TASK;

2. 分區技術

Oracle 11g 的分區技術允許用戶將大型表格分割成更小的、可管理的部分。這不僅提高了查詢性能,還能夠簡化數據的管理。用戶可以根據時間、範圍或列表等多種方式進行分區,從而更靈活地處理數據。

示例:

CREATE TABLE sales
(
    sale_id NUMBER,
    sale_date DATE,
    amount NUMBER
)
PARTITION BY RANGE (sale_date)
(
    PARTITION p1 VALUES LESS THAN (TO_DATE('2022-01-01', 'YYYY-MM-DD')),
    PARTITION p2 VALUES LESS THAN (TO_DATE('2023-01-01', 'YYYY-MM-DD'))
);

3. 資料庫閃回技術

資料庫閃回技術是 Oracle 11g 的一大亮點,允許用戶在數據損壞或誤刪的情況下迅速恢復數據。用戶可以選擇恢復到特定的時間點,這對於數據安全性至關重要。

示例:

FLASHBACK TABLE sales TO TIMESTAMP (SYSTIMESTAMP - INTERVAL '1' HOUR);

4. 實時查詢功能

Oracle 11g 提供了實時查詢功能,允許用戶在不影響系統性能的情況下,進行即時數據查詢。這一功能特別適合需要快速反應的業務場景,如金融交易和即時報告。

示例:

SELECT * FROM sales WHERE sale_date >= SYSDATE - INTERVAL '1' DAY;

5. 高可用性和災難恢復

Oracle 11g 提供了多種高可用性和災難恢復的解決方案,包括 Oracle Data Guard 和 Real Application Clusters (RAC)。這些技術確保了系統在面對故障時的持續運行,並能夠快速恢復。

示例:

-- 啟用 Data Guard
ALTER DATABASE ENABLE ARCHIVE LOG;

總結

Oracle 11g 的五大獨特特能使其成為企業數據管理的理想選擇。自動化管理、分區技術、資料庫閃回、實時查詢以及高可用性和災難恢復功能,無疑提升了數據庫的性能和安全性。對於需要穩定和高效數據處理的企業來說,選擇合適的 VPS 解決方案是至關重要的。了解更多關於 香港VPS 的資訊,請訪問我們的網站。